Distributorships and Dealerships / Franchising
Many industries market their products through systems of distributors, dealers, licensees, franchisees, sales representatives, or some combination of these. Our Distributorships and Dealerships / Franchising attorneys have substantial experience with these systems in federal and state courts, state regulatory agencies and arbitration proceedings. We have also provided legal counseling and training to sales and marketing personnel on marketing programs as a proactive measure.
